Pixies Confirm European Tour
Mike_Diver by Mike Diver February 4th, 2004
After a lengthy 'will they or won't they' debate, the Pixies have confirmed that they are planning a full US and European tour for later this year.

The band are already confirmed to appear at this year's Coachella festival in California. The tour will be their first since 1993.

A spokesman for the band remarked that details are yet to be finalised, but told reporters: "For a long time, it was far from certain that this would actually happen. However, you may be interested to learn that, at last, the reunion has been confirmed. Their booking agents have been confirming shows with promoters over the last few days."

The Pixies are expected to play a series of warm up shows prior to Coachella, probably in Canada. Other festival appearances have been rumoured, including Glastonbury and T in the Park, as well as a possible support slot on the Red Hot Chili Peppers' European tour this summer.
